The waitress told us that she would help us crunch the numbers and find the best combination. When we asked her about ordering Combo B with additional lobster tail and king crab legs, she said it would be an extra $25 on top of the Combo B price. We eventually ordered Combo A with additional lobster tail and king crab legs, thinking that the additional item only costs $25. When the bill comes, the small portion king crab legs actually cost us a whopping $69. We balked at it and asked her to check if there is a way to lower the bill due to miscommunication. She said she could give us a $5 off. We did not check the new receipt and left. After arriving home, I found that she added $16.95 for extra mussels, even though we did not order it. What a shady place! They are preying on unsuspecting customers. By the way, the cajun sauce also tastes kind of funny and unhealthy.

Good Cajun food considering it’s the Bay Area. We got a seafood boil combo - the sauce was flavorful and the food was good quality and filling. Also enjoyed some of their more unusual offerings like fried frog legs, gator bites, and cajun wings. Good service and fair price.
